BRENTWOOD, Tenn. -- Softspikes, the world's leading golf cleat brand and the #1 Cleat on Tour, announced that Black Widow Grips, the bold and innovative new line of golf grips, made a big statement on the Nationwide Tour, as this weekend's top 15 place finisher at the Melwood Prince George's County Open played with the Widow Maker model on his entire set of clubs.

The new Black Widow Grips line, which has received rave reviews since debuting at the 2010 PGA Merchandise Show, continues to succeed on both the PGA Tour and the Nationwide Tour, with top players achieving success with the grips in competition. Created to meet the demands of players at all levels, the Black Widow Grips line offers five distinct models: Tour Silk, Widow Maker, Signature, Fusion and Edge, which include either Web Traction Technology or the Softspikes traction inspired interlocking "S" pattern and black widow spider icons, along with bold designs.

To further promote the Black Widow Grips line, earlier this year Softspikes launched www.bwgrips.com, an interactive website that features a number of insightful pages that educate consumers about golf grips. The new website also features a tutorial on how to properly clean the grips, complete with easy-to-follow photos and tips, and an instructional video that teaches consumers how to properly install their grips. Suggested retail price for the Black Widow Grips, which arrived at on-course green grass stores nationwide in early April, vary from $3.99 to $9.39 per grip depending on the model.
